Kitatta knows what he has done to this world — Court Martial explains why he’s not detained in Luzira

The General Court Martial has today defended its action of transferring former Boda boda 2010 patron Abdalla Kitatta from Luzira prison to Makindye military police detention centre despite him being a civilian.

According to Lt.Gen. Andrew Guti, the army court chairman, the action was reached for Kitatta’s safety as he stated that; “He is there for his own safety. He knows what he has done to this world.”

Guti also played down claims from Kitatta’s lawyer Shaban Sanywa that his client was ill and needed health attention.  “The health facility we have (at Makindye) is excellent to handle his ailment,”Guti said.

The army court adjourned the matter to April 23 for trial to commence.
